Да нет, не для того чтобы просто использовать, для облегчения работы, создания слоя, который будет делать всю закадровую логику предоставляя методы для вызова экшенов и получения стора.
Спросил я здесь по тому, что почти всегда находится кто-то, кто дает очень дельный совет, или тот, кто раньше сталкивался с таким вопросом и опять же, дает дельный совет.
Например, вместо того чтобы коннектить компонент к стору и пробрасывать туда стейт и диспатч, создать объект с методами для работы со стором. Его уже можно импортировать.
Понимаю что могу звучать глупо, но я джун, мне не знакомы бест практисы (в большинстве вопросов), даже если есть какая-то идея, не понятно как ее развить, например эту. Не понятно в том плане что, нужно ли это вообще? Как организовывать архитектуру? Код же скорее всего будут смотреть и редактировать другие разработчики, не хотелось бы оставлять для них какую-то кашу из разных идей и решений.
Александр Маджугин, тоже работаю над таким проектом, но там уже бывший фронтендер постарался, бандл весил 2.5мб на девелопе (4мб на проде), после разбиения на чанки основной весит 1.4мб.
Может гет параметрами? Хук useEffect будет загружать первую страницу если гет параметров нет, и любую другую если они есть. Так можно будет переходить на страницу по ссылке.
А зачем оно вам? Не помню чтобы я где-то видел что валидация действует только после написания текста. Обычно срабатывает после потери фокуса, как вы и говорите.
Дмитрий, короче, нашел проблему, оказывается в оберточный компонент этот компонент передавался в таком виде () => <ComponentName />, сперва я убрал стрелочную функцию и выскочила ошибка, затем я убрал литералы тега и все заработало, без понятия из-за чего такое поведение)
IsAdding пока не трогаем, я ее осознанное не дописал. isEditing выводится в условиях в таблицах. Пробовал выводить явно, изменений не видно. Если isEditing === true то должна появиться форма вместо текста.
Константин Б., желание то есть, только что и как искать еще видать не научился, сам не люблю задавать вопрос после 5 минут самостоятельного поиска, просто раньше не работал с гет параметрам, только в случае запросов к апи (джун), вам спасибо за наводку.
Спросил я здесь по тому, что почти всегда находится кто-то, кто дает очень дельный совет, или тот, кто раньше сталкивался с таким вопросом и опять же, дает дельный совет.
Например, вместо того чтобы коннектить компонент к стору и пробрасывать туда стейт и диспатч, создать объект с методами для работы со стором. Его уже можно импортировать.
Понимаю что могу звучать глупо, но я джун, мне не знакомы бест практисы (в большинстве вопросов), даже если есть какая-то идея, не понятно как ее развить, например эту. Не понятно в том плане что, нужно ли это вообще? Как организовывать архитектуру? Код же скорее всего будут смотреть и редактировать другие разработчики, не хотелось бы оставлять для них какую-то кашу из разных идей и решений.